    Main Concepts, State of the Art and Future Research Questions in Sentiment Analysis.

    This article has multiple objectives. First of all, the fundamental concepts and challenges of the research ïŹeld known as Sentiment Analysis (SA) are presented. Secondly, a summary of a chronological account of the research performed in SA is provided as well as some bibliometric indicators that shed some light on the most frequently used techniques for addressing the central aspects of SA. The geographical locations of where the research took place are also given. In closing, it is argued that there is no hard evidence that fuzzy sets or hybrid approaches encompassing unsupervised learning, fuzzy sets and a solid psychological background of emotions could not be at least as effective as supervised learning techniques

    Terminology and Knowledge Representation. Italian Linguistic Resources for the Archaeological Domain

    Knowledge representation is heavily based on using terminology, due to the fact that many terms have precise meanings in a specific domain but not in others. As a consequence, terms becomes unambiguous and clear, and at last, being useful for conceptualizations, are used as a starting point for formalizations. Starting from an analysis of problems in existing dictionaries, in this paper we present formalized Italian Linguistic Resources (LRs) for the Archaeological domain, in which we integrate/couple formal ontology classes and properties into/to electronic dictionary entries, using a standardized conceptual reference model. We also add Linguistic Linked Open Data (LLOD) references in order to guarantee the interoperability between linguistic and language resources, and therefore to represent knowledge

    Reasoning under fuzzy vagueness and probabilistic uncertainty in the Semantic Web

    Combining data from many different sources or from sources that are not entirely trusted brings challenges to the automated processing of such data. Knowledge presented in natural language is another challenge for computing. In the semantic web, many applications such as personal agents need to be able to manage multiple kinds of uncertainty. There are two main approaches to modeling uncertainty in the literature - fuzzy and probabilistic. These approaches model semantically different types of uncertainty. This paper focuses on approaches that combine both fuzzy and probabilistic reasoning in one framework to provide automated agents the capability to deal with both types of uncertainty

    Mining Linguistic Associations for Emergent Flood Prediction Adjustment

    Floods belong to the most hazardous natural disasters and their disaster management heavily relies on precise forecasts. These forecasts are provided by physical models based on differential equations. However, these models do depend on unreliable inputs such as measurements or parameter estimations which causes undesirable inaccuracies. Thus, an appropriate data-mining analysis of the physical model and its precision based on features that determine distinct situations seems to be helpful in adjusting the physical model. An application of fuzzy GUHA method in flood peak prediction is presented. Measured water flow rate data from a system for flood predictions were used in order to mine fuzzy association rules expressed in natural language. The provided data was firstly extended by a generation of artificial variables (features). The resulting variables were later on translated into fuzzy GUHA tables with help of Evaluative Linguistic Expressions in order to mine associations. The found associations were interpreted as fuzzy IF-THEN rules and used jointly with the Perception-based Logical Deduction inference method to predict expected time shift of flow rate peaks forecasted by the given physical model. Results obtained from this adjusted model were statistically evaluated and the improvement in the forecasting accuracy was confirmed
